Kids go free at Ulusaba Rock Lodge in 2009!

Monday, February 9th, 2009

Yet another special offer has recently become available, and this time it is ideal for parents as kids go free at Ulusaba Rock Lodge in 2009.

Ulusaba Rock Lodge is one of Richard Branson’s lodges in the Sabi Sand area of the greater Kruger Park, and is in an area well known for it’s exceptional lion and leopard sightings.  This offer allows kids under 12 to stay for free when they share with their parents, and they can all join Ulusaba’s Cubs Club, which offers a range of safari activities for kids.  Older kids (over 6 years) can also join the adults on the main game drives.

This fantasic offer represents a saving of R2000 (approx £140) per child per night!

Lions Tour Countdown – 16 weeks to go!

Friday, February 6th, 2009

With the RBS 6 Nations kicking off this weekend, thoughts again turn to rugby and the build up to the British Lions tour of South Africa which kicks off on the 30th May…just 16 weeks away.

There are still packages and match tickets available for fans planning travelling to follow the Lions, however rooms are becoming a bit scarce, and it is probably is good idea to get this booked asap to avoid disappointment.

As well as offering a fantastic sporting spectacle, South Africa is is one of the world’s great holiday destinations, and the chance of adding an Kruger Park Safari or trip to Cape Town is sure to appeal to many fans.
